Don’t expect to see the sun if you visit Singapore in February, like I did. Wasn’t raining too bad though, I’d say constant drizzling but that’s about it. The good thing is that Singapore is rich of indoor activities, a hefty abundance of fancy malls, lots of rooftop bars and restaurants.
Resembling Dubai a lot, both cities are similar in terms of architecture, pretentious nightlife, internationalism, and generally being an undebatable business hub. The city of Singapore is beautiful to visit.
Excellent street food can be found, the cuisine there is a mix between Chinese, Indian and Malay.
